Match Summary
Kashiwa Reysol defeated Consadole Sapporo 2:1. The match was played in J1 League 2023. Goals were scored by M. Hosoya 21′, M. Hosoya 38′, S. Sarachat 51′. 3 yellow cards were shown. Consadole Sapporo had 72% possession while Kashiwa Reysol held 28%. Consadole Sapporo had 20 shots (6 on target) compared to 13 (4 on target) for Kashiwa Reysol. Expected goals: Consadole Sapporo 1.67 — Kashiwa Reysol 1.51. Consadole Sapporo made 3 substitutions, Kashiwa Reysol made 5.

Lineups
Consadole Sapporo lined up in a 3-4-2-1 formation under M. Petrović, while Kashiwa Reysol deployed a 4-4-2 under M. Ihara.
